The Golden Era of PSP Games: A Look Back at the Best Titles

The PlayStation Portable (PSP) was one of the most innovative handheld consoles of its time, offering a vast library of games that spanned multiple genres. Released in 2004, the PSP brought console-quality experiences to the palm of your hand, allowing gamers to take their favorite games on the go. While it was eventually overshadowed by newer handheld devices and smartphones, the PSP remains a beloved console, and its game library is filled with some truly exceptional titles.

One of the most iconic games of the PSP era was God of War: Chains of Olympus. This prequel to the main God of War series brought the brutal, Presidencc fast-paced combat of Kratos to the handheld console, delivering an experience that felt right at home with the mainline entries. The game’s stunning visuals, engaging combat mechanics, and compelling story made it a standout in the PSP’s library. Chains of Olympus proved that the PSP was capable of delivering console-quality experiences, and it remains one of the best PSP games to date.

Another standout title for the PSP was Grand Theft Auto: Liberty City Stories. As part of the iconic Grand Theft Auto series, Liberty City Stories brought the open-world chaos and criminal antics of GTA to the PSP. Players could roam the streets of Liberty City, engage in various side missions, and explore the vast urban environment. The game’s engaging story, combined with the ability to create havoc in a fully realized world, made it one of the best open-world experiences available on the handheld.

For fans of strategy and turn-based combat, Tactics Ogre: Let Us Cling Together was another gem in the PSP library. A remaster of the classic tactical RPG, Let Us Cling Together offered a deep and immersive strategy experience with a branching narrative and numerous tactical options. The game’s complex mechanics and rich storytelling earned it a devoted following, and it remains a standout RPG for the PSP.

While the PSP may no longer be in production, its library of games remains a treasure trove of unforgettable experiences. From epic action-adventures to immersive open-world titles and strategy games, the PSP provided a wide variety of genres for players to explore. For anyone who grew up with the PSP, its game catalog is a testament to the console’s legacy and its contribution to the gaming world.
